Thanks to Richard Petty’s success on the NASCAR circuit and frankly a lack of stylish competitors, the Dodge Chargers of the post-Hemi 1972-74 era were very popular street cars. The example here, from 1973, has been treated to a full rotisserie restoration and further customized in keeping its heritage of performance. Many Chargers from this time were powered by small-block or even slant-6 engines, but beneath the hood here resides the biggest bullet in the Mopar arsenal: the RB-series 440 CI Magnum V-8 engine.
This mill is heavily breathed-on, featuring Edelbrock aluminum heads and Edelbrock dual-quad intake, a FiTech dual-quad fuel injection, MSD electronic ignition with matched MSD distributor, a modern serpentine belt layout with custom 150-amp alternator, and TTI Performance ceramic-coated polished headers. Behind this is an A727 TorqueFlite automatic transmission and an Auburn Sure Grip upgraded differential, a driveline combination able to match the power potential. However, this is not a drag package but a street sweeper.
Undercarriage retrofits include custom powder-coated suspension parts, subframe connectors, Wilwood power disc brakes on all four corners (6-piston front and 4-piston rear calipers) and Borgeson power steering. After admiring the exterior covered in Spies Hecker Candy Red, open the door to find a custom leather interior in tan with power seats featuring three-point seatbelts, a custom headliner, power locks and windows, and new glass and weather stripping. A group of Dakota Digital gauges and Vintage Air with Dakota controls and a Retrosound stereo with amplifier complete the dash.
Exterior work included extensive prep with the fenders, hood, and trunk dip-cleaned, and the body and doors were media-blasted. Installing classic-look 1971 R/T front and rear bumpers give this car a fresh appearance no other 1973 factory car likely had ever had. This car rides on a set of Foose 18-inch wheels wrapped in new BF Goodrich rubber. Ready for the boulevard, highway and smiles of enjoyment, it really is a chargin’ Charger.
